Batman Arkham Games Likely Coming to Switch This August

Thanks to (probably) an intern hitting Publish too early, we got a good hint the Batman Arkham Games are coming to Switch.

French retailer WTT posted retail information for “Batman Arkham Collection – Switch” from Rocksteady Studios on their store page. But, they quickly deleted it. The store page noted the game will cost €59.99 and has a release date of August 31st.


Pulling up the page now only brings an error message reading “L’article demandé est indisponible, discontinué ou non publié.” This translates to “The requested article is unavailable, discontinued or not published.”

Typically, it’s easy to dismiss something like this. However, WTT had a similar slip-up with the Witcher 3: Wild Hunt port to Switch. So, this gives some credit to the rumors that Batman Arkham games are coming to Switch soon.

Batman Arkham Collection

The Batman Arkham Collection includes Arkham Asylum, Arkham City, and Arkham Knight. The collection was released for Playstation, XBox and PC back in 2018. The only Batman Arkham title on any Nintendo console is Arkham City, which was released on the Wii U. However, the Wii U had notably low sales, so this almost doesn’t count.

This could be good for hyping up Rocksteady’s next title in the Arkham series, Suicide Squad: Kill the Justice League. The action-adventure game follows Task Force X (a.k.a. the Suicide Squad) on a mission to take down the Justice League. Currently, the game listed to release this year.

But rumors are circling the game will be delayed until 2023. So, we can only speculate if the Batman Arkham port will coincide with the Suicide Squad release.
